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ion Criteria
- •All groups:
- •\-Age 18\-50 years
- •Control Group:
- •\-No current or previous symptoms of knee pain in patellar tendon or its insertion
- •\-VISA score \> 80
- •Symptomatic group:
- •\-Current symptoms of knee pain in patellar tendon or its patellar or tibial insertion in connection with training and competition, in one knee.
- •\-Symptoms for over three months to exclude acute inflammatory tendon problems and de novo partial ruptures.
- •\-VISA score \< 80
- •Previous symptoms group:
Exclusion Criteria
- •\- Neurologic or neuromuscular disorder
- •\- Other lower extremity injury or disease that might interfere with the measurements
